Trump’s 15% global tariffs likely to start this week, US Treasury chief says

AI Summary
US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ent indicated that President Trump's planned increase of a universal tariff from 10% to 15% is likely to be implemented this week. The tariff increase follows Trump's initial imposition of a 10% levy after the Supreme Court invalidated much of his previous tariff system. Trump then quickly threatened to raise the rate to 15%. While the 10% charge took effect last month, the administration did not immediately increase it. Bessent's statement provides the clearest timeline yet for the tariff hike, despite previous suggestions that the higher rate might not be universally applied.
